 <title>Rescues off Cape Ann coast</title>
  <link>http://www.gloucestertimes.com/punews/local_story_200224659.html</link>
  <description>Nine beachgoers dragged out to sea by a high ebbing tide and head-high waves from a distant Tropical Storm Bertha were carried back to safety on Long Beach on Thursday afternoon by a group of surfers and a part-time lobsterman.

 <title>Americans eating less fish</title>
  <link>http://www.gloucestertimes.com/punews/local_story_199231730.html</link>
  <description>WASHINGTON  and mdash; Americans are eating slightly less seafood, despite continuing reports of its health benefits.
Seafood consumption totaled 4.908 billion pounds in 2007, down from 4.944 billion a year earlier, the National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ration reported yesterday.</description>

 <title>Fresh look for Man at Wheel; Names of 5,370 fishermen lost at sea can now be read</title>
  <link>http://www.gloucestertimes.com/punews/local_story_198225750.html</link>
  <description>The Man at the Wheel has his "crew" back.
The 10 bronze plaques bearing the names of the 5,370 Gloucester fishermen who have died at sea since the start of record-keeping in Gloucester could be archivally verified, were reinstalled yesterday after their first major refurbishing since the memorial was erected in a semicircle nearby the statue in 2000.</description>
